Dubai: The Emirates Airline Festival of Literature (February 1-6), one of the world’s top ten literary festivals, begins today at InterContinental Dubai Festival City and Mohammed bin Rashid Library. Dubai: The Emirates Literature Foundation announced, that they will celebrate the 15th anniversary of the Emirates Airline Festival of Literature from February 1-6, 2023. The Festival will return to their original neighbourhood, near Dubai Creek. This day in history we feature Nadine Gordimer. She was a South African writer and political activist, who received the Nobel Prize in Literature on this day in 1991. ABU DHABI: The ‘Library on Wheels’ initiative, operated by the Abu Dhabi Department of Education and Knowledge (ADEK), will continue its tour of the emirate on a year-long basis. The Nobel Prize for literature has been awarded to the novelist Abdulrazak Gurnah, “for his uncompromising and compassionate penetration of the effects of colonialism and the fate of the refugee in between cultures and continents.” Gurnah was born in Tanzania in 1948 but moved to England at a young age.
